Albany, GA vs Brunswick, GA
Cost of Living Comparison
Albany, GA is more affordable by 0.0 index points
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Category | Albany, GA | Brunswick, GA |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 87.7 | 87.7 | -0.0 |
| Housing | 54.6 | 56.3 | -1.7 |
| Goods | 96.3 | 96.3 | 0.0 |
| Utilities | 88.3 | 87.3 | +1.0 |
| Other Services | 98.7 | 98.7 | 0.0 |
Income & Housing Comparison
| Metric | Albany, GA | Brunswick, GA |
|---|---|---|
| Median Household Income | $53,173 | $60,777 |
| Median Home Value | $139,900 | $202,400 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$912 | $972 |
| Per Capita Income | $28,313 | $35,578 |
